Elastomeric pipe insulation is a flexible foam sleeve designed to wrap around water and HVAC pipes. It's commonly used in homes and light industrial settings to cut heat loss, prevent condensation, and reduce noise.

💡 What is pipe insulation used for in home HVAC and plumbing systems? This handy guide covers core benefits and typical uses. - reduces heat loss and energy use in HVAC and plumbing runs - prevents condensation on cold pipes to avoid moisture and mold - dampens noise and vibration for a quieter system - easy to install on typical 1/2 inch wall pipes with flexible elastomeric foam
